PDF'den Sayfaları Çıkarma Python'da

Python’da bir PDF’den sayfaları çıkarmak basit ve etkilidir. Kullanıcılara belirli bilgileri izole etme, özetler oluşturma veya ilgili bölümleri paylaşma imkanı tanır; tüm dosyayı dağıtmadan. Doğru araçlarla, sadece birkaç satır kodla sayfaları bölebilir, kaydedebilir veya yeniden düzenleyebilirsiniz. Bu blog yazısında, Python kullanarak bir PDF belgesinden sayfaları adım adım nasıl çıkaracağımızı keşfedeceğiz. Derinlemesine dalın ve Python ile PDF manipülasyonunun gücünü açığa çıkarın!

Bu makale aşağıdaki konuları kapsamaktadır:

Python PDF Bölücü Kütüphanesi

Aspose.PDF for Python PDF belgeleriyle çalışmak için tasarlanmış sağlam bir kütüphanedir. PDF belgesinden sayfaları çıkarmayı basitleştirir. Kullanıcı dostu API’si ile geliştiriciler PDF dosyalarını kolayca manipüle edebilir. Kütüphane, sayfa çıkarma, dönüştürme ve düzenleme gibi geniş bir işlevsellik yelpazesini destekler. Aspose.PDF for Python, PDF görevlerini verimli bir şekilde otomatikleştirmek isteyen geliştiriciler için idealdir.

Aspose.PDF for Python, bir PDF belgesinden sayfaları çıkarmak için mükemmel bir seçim yapan birkaç özellik sunar:

  • Entegrasyon Kolaylığı: Kütüphane mevcut Python uygulamalarına kolayca entegre edilebilir.
  • Esneklik: Çeşitli PDF işlemlerini destekler, böylece çıkarma sürecini özelleştirebilirsiniz.
  • Gelişmiş Özelleştirme Seçenekleri: Kullanıcılar, çıkarma sırasında sayfa boyutlarını, formatlarını ve içeriğini manipüle edebilir.

Aspose.PDF for Python ile başlamanız için kütüphaneyi kurmanız gerekir. Bunu releases sayfasından indirebilir veya aşağıdaki pip komutunu kullanarak kurabilirsiniz:

pip install aspose-pdf

Bir PDF Belgesinden Bir Sayfa Çıkarma Python’da

Aspose.PDF for Python kullanarak bir PDF belgesinden bir sayfa çıkarmak için bu adımları izleyin:

  1. Kütüphaneden gerekli sınıfları içe aktarın.
  2. Document sınıfını kullanarak PDF belgesini yükleyin.
  3. Çıkarmak istediğiniz sayfayı belirtin.
  4. Çıkarılan sayfa için yeni bir Document nesnesi oluşturun.
  5. add(Page) yöntemini kullanarak bir sayfa ekleyin.
  6. save() yöntemini kullanarak yeni belgeyi kaydedin.

İşte bu adımları gösteren bir Python kod örneği:

Bir PDF Belgesinden Bir Sayfa Çıkarma Python'da

Bir PDF Belgesinden Bir Sayfa Çıkarma Python’da

Bir PDF’den Bir Sayfa Aralığı Çıkarma Python’da

Aspose.PDF for Python kullanarak bir PDF belgesinden bir sayfa aralığı da çıkarabilirsiniz. Bu adımları izleyin:

  1. Gerekli sınıfları içe aktarın.
  2. Document sınıfını kullanarak PDF belgesini yükleyin.
  3. Çıkarmak istediğiniz sayfa aralığını belirtin.
  4. Çıkarılan sayfalar için yeni bir Document nesnesi oluşturun.
  5. add(Page) yöntemini kullanarak bir sayfa ekleyin.
  6. save() yöntemini kullanarak yeni belgeyi kaydedin.

Bu kullanım durumu için bir Python kod örneği:

Bir PDF'den Bir Sayfa Aralığı Çıkarma Python'da

Bir PDF’den Bir Sayfa Aralığı Çıkarma Python’da

PDF Sayfalarını Python ile Ayırma

Bazı durumlarda, her sayfayı ayrı bir PDF dosyasına ayırmanız gerekebilir. Python kullanarak bir PDF’yi tek tek sayfalara ayırmak için şu adımları izleyebilirsiniz:

  1. Document sınıfını kullanarak PDF dosyasını yükleyin.
  2. Document.pages koleksiyonundaki sayfalar üzerinde döngü oluşturun.
  3. Her sayfa için:
    • Yeni bir Document nesnesi oluşturun.
    • Sayfayı yeni belgeye Document.pages.add(Page) yöntemiyle ekleyin.
    • Yeni PDF’yi Document.save() yöntemiyle kaydedin.

Aşağıdaki örnek, her bir sayfayı Python kullanarak nasıl ayıracağınızı gösterir.

Python ile PDF Sayfalarını Ayırma

Python ile PDF Sayfalarını Ayırma

Ücretsiz Lisans Alın

Aspose ürünlerini denemek ister misiniz? Ücretsiz geçici lisans almak için lisans sayfasını ziyaret edin. Kolaydır ve Aspose kütüphanelerinin tam potansiyelini herhangi bir ücret ödemeden keşfetmenize olanak tanır.

PDF’yi Çevrimiçi Ayırma

PDF belgelerinizi ayırmak için çevrimiçi aracımızı da deneyebilirsiniz. PDF ayırma işlemi ücretsizdir, kullanımı kolaydır ve PDF belgelerini hızlı bir şekilde ayırmak için doğru sonuçlar sağlar.

PDF Belgesinden Sayfaları Çıkarma: Ücretsiz Kaynaklar

Bu bloga ek olarak, PDF manipülasyonu konusundaki bilginizi artırmanıza yardımcı olacak bir dizi kaynak sunuyoruz. Dokümantasyonumuzu, eğitimlerimizi ve topluluk forumlarımızı keşfederek becerilerinizi geliştirebilirsiniz.

Sonuç

Bu blog yazısında, Aspose.PDF for Python kullanarak bir PDF belgesinden sayfaları nasıl çıkaracağınızı inceledik. Kütüphanenin özelliklerini tartıştık ve tekil ve çoklu sayfaların nasıl çıkarılacağını adım adım anlattık. PDF manipülasyon yeteneklerinizi geliştirmek için Aspose.PDF for Python hakkında daha fazla keşif yapmanızı tavsiye ederiz.

Herhangi bir sorunuz varsa veya daha fazla yardıma ihtiyacınız varsa, lütfen ücretsiz destek forumumuza başvurun.

Ayrıca Bakın